Plenty of drama takes place on stage at a National Final. Especially when that final is Ukraine’s Vidbir 2019. Just think about Jamala asking that question. So it’s incredibly refreshing to see that when the cameras were off, the Vidbir studio was full of fun, laughter and nipple tassels.

In a vlog uploaded to her Youtube channel, Maruv has documented her behind-the-scenes Vidbir experience and it’s a real hoot. Bang!

Maruv will go down in Eurovision history as at the centre of political drama, so it’s heartwarming to see a more personal side to her in this vlog. She gives us an insight into the real camaraderie she shared with her team throughout the contest.

There’s the rehearsals, all done in “Stripper Shoes” (ouch!) as she mastered the infamous leg kick. Then there are the scenes where we see that everyone in the crew has a nickname printed on hoodies, with Maruv’s being the ever-fitting “Main Pussy Queen”. She even gets a birthday surprise before Vidbir — a Siren Song birthday cake! Seriously. There are legs made from icing, y’all!

Between the laughter, Maruv isn’t afraid to show us moments of vulnerability. Before her semi-final performance she tells the camera, “we are really exhausted. All we want is a good sleep. But we’ll get our sh*t together, we’ll cheer ourselves up. We’ll go there and deliver something”. She doesn’t shy away from the judge’s critique either, making light of the constructive criticism she received during the Semi Final.

When the cameras started rolling, Maruv certainly lived up to her reputation as Ukraine’s baddest b****. When one reporter asked “is the final performance going to be even more explicit?” following her qualification to the Final, she responded in the best way possible: “What are you talking about? I’m dressed like a monk! Sometimes my ass fell out, but only sometimes. Other than that I’m covered from head to toe.”

The vlog ends with the caption “The Rest is History…” and a promise that her video diary will be continued. We’re going to miss Maruv on the Eurovision stage, so all hail the Main Pussy Queen for filling our Ukraine shaped void with these delightful vlogs.
